Lmao are you me? Is this my alt account or sth? Cause I've been in the same conundrum lately. After much research I'll probably end up with one of the Rapoos. Either VT1 or VT9 Air. Rapoo mice get reviewed by Techpowerup and there's not much complaining from the reviewer. On the other hand Attack Shark X6 with the top button placement is perfect but they have horrible QC. Their charging dock becomes paper-weight after sometime and sometimes the mouse doesn't wake up after eternal sleep. Though it's concerning that you haven't pinned down your preferred size yet. VT9 (not Pro Mini & Air) is similar in size to the Superlight. While X6 and VT1 are a fair bit smaller.

if you like the Basilisk shape you can try Attack Shark V6, its a wireless and much lighter copy of the Basilisk, does not have rubber sides tho, you can order it with rubber grip tape that you can manually attach
